I believe you're the guy to speak to regarding USD fork conversion on my 14.
Title: Re: Newbee
Post by: seth on Sunday, 05 November 2017, 08:40 AM
i can tell you what i have also the same set up as blubber has to .
i have forks from a Bking with 75mm extenders from extreme creations (Australia) and thug yokes from billet bike bits(uk)
gives radial calipers from the Bking I'm also going to use clutch and brake master cylinders from a Bking.
everything here just not fitted yet.

That's a good set up. I'd like something similar.
King forks have slightly softer internals than the Gen-2 Busa but that's easily fixed.
King also gets a radial master that the early Gen-2's didn't and having traditional
Bars the Kings master cylinder sits at a much nicer angle than using a Busa's.
